What is Calorie to Petajoule Conversion?
Calorie (cal) and petajoule (PJ) are both units used to measure energy, but they serve different purposes depending on the scale of the measurement. If you ever need to convert calorie to petajoule, knowing the exact conversion formula is essential.
Cal to pj Conversion Formula:
One Calorie is equal to 4.184e-15 Petajoule.
Formula: 1 cal = 4.184e-15 PJ
By using this conversion factor, you can easily convert any energy from calorie to petajoule with precision.
Convert 1 Calorie to Petajoule
To convert 1 calorie to petajoule, multiply the value by 4.184e-15 since:
1 calorie = 4.184e-15 petajoule
So:
1 × 4.184e-15 = 4.184e-15
Result: 1 calorie = 4.184e-15 petajoule
